    As a

    Senior Embedded Software Engineer


    at Plexus, you will be part of a team developing embedded software for products across a wide range of industries and at all phases of product development.

    You will also collaborate closely with other disciplines, including electrical, mechanical, user-centered design, and others.

    Key Job Accountabilities:


    Develops engineering/product concepts that are innovative, high-quality, cost-appropriate, and satisfy all stakeholder's (customer, manufacturing, material, agency, etc.) needs and requirements through an established area of technical specialty and mentorship of others on the global discipline team.

    Demonstrates effective communications (teleconference, email, and in-person) through interaction with customers (internal and external) regarding project technical subject matter.
    Demonstrates skill in the full product realization process, as it applies to their role.

    Demonstrates the ability to work independently in multiple phases for the Product Realization Process, without direction from mentors or functional management.

    Assists project management in the development of proposals to ensure accurate technical, staffing, budgetary, and schedule content.

    Supports the Lean culture and effectively utilizes Lean Sigma concepts and tools to identify and eliminate waste while improving processes.

    Technical Qualifications
    Hands on experience working with Embedded software / ARM Microcontrollers (Sensors & Actuators)
    Working experience with C++ & STL
    Deep understanding of Object Oriented Design & Object Oriented Programming (OOD/OOP)
    Familiar with common OO Design Patterns and principles

    Education/Experience Qualifications:
    A minimum of a Bachelor's degree in Engineering is required.
    Five (5) years of related experience is required.

    About Us

    Since 1979, Plexus has been partnering with companies to create the products that build a better world.

    We are a team of over 20,000 individuals who are dedicated to providing Design and Development, Supply Chain Solutions, New Product Introduction, Manufacturing and Sustainability Services.

    Plexus is a global leader that specializes in serving customers in industries with highly complex products and demanding regulatory environments.
